This the my very first Busse, an NMFSH in Jungle Camo with Paper handles. I got her from another member on the Exchange, and it was LOVE at first sight.
I really didn't know what to expect. I'd never handled a Busse, and just ordered my Rucki from Swamprat. After drooling over pix and posts, I knew I had to tryout an NMFSH. All I can say is WOW! you have just got to hold one of these truly impressive pieced of INFI in your hand! I don't know how else to explain it to fellow Busse newbies/piglets-in-training, other than it feels like you could chop down a stand of trees, wipe her down and then cut up a steak with the NMFSH. The other big knife I have to compare the NMFSH to is a Fallkniven A2, and the A2 is positively petite compared to the NMFSH. The A2 has since gone into the sell/gift box and a second NMFSH replaced the A2.
